CERAMIC CAPACITORS
High Capacitance Stacked Capacitors
General characteristics
SC / SV Series
FEATURES
• Multilayer stacked ceramic capacitors
• Dielectric type II
• Capacitance range: 47nf to 390
µF
• Voltage range: 50 V
DC
to 500 V
DC
• SV Series: 2 wires components
• SC Series: 4 wires (W4), Dual In Line (DIL) or ribbons
terminations

PACKAGING
«Blister» boxes:
For all products, special «blister» boxes are used to optimize
the protection of the parts during the carriage and the stor-
age. Depending upon the termination (with or without con-
nection) and the size, the number of the parts in each box
is defined. Please, consult us for more details.
